About The Position

The Director of Graduate Programs & Admissions at the Argyros College of Business and Economics ( ACBE ) is the leader responsible for admissions and enrollment management across all ACBE graduate programs. The Director of Graduate Business Programs will lead the marketing, recruitment, and enrollment activities for the graduate programs and support the administration of each program. The incumbent will build and cultivate relationships with internal and external stakeholders to develop partnerships to meet enrollment targets and support operational efficiency. This position is also responsible for business school rankings (data collection and strategy) and cultivating a culture of diversity and belonging.

Responsibilities

  • Enrollment Management and Graduate Admissions Develop best practices for recruiting prospective students to ensure applications from high-quality candidates to the graduate program’s portfolio.
  • Actively manage the admissions funnel and make data-driven decisions regarding resource allocations while providing personalized service to graduate business applicants from application to orientation.
  • Lead the admissions committees for ACBE graduate programs and schedule and conduct graduate business program interviews.
  • Manage scholarship and fellowship pool in compliance with University guidelines to meet the school’s revenue targets.
  • Provide exceptional customer service by explaining the College’s portfolio of educational programs, expected outcomes, student services, and financial considerations to prospective graduate students.
  • Meet the targeted enrollment and admissions goals for each of the ACBE’s graduate programs.
  • Oversee the financial aid allocations for students in all ACBE graduate programs.
  • Develop a dashboard to provide weekly admission reports to the ACBE leadership team and compile enrollment statistics to assess the effectiveness of recruitment efforts.
  • Develop a strategy and plan to grow international student population.
  • Program Management Partner with faculty and relevant committees to ensure the academic offerings in ACBE graduate programs are dynamic and innovative.
  • Collaborate with Director of Student Success to provide intentional co-curricular programming that enhances the graduate student life experience.
  • Prepare reports and administer student satisfaction surveys.
  • Oversee updates to the graduate student catalog.
  • Collect, analyze, and maintain key data related to students in compliance with national reporting standards for accreditation and rankings.
  • Leadership and Supervision Create a strategic vision for the ACBE graduate programs office in partnership with leadership through long-term strategic plans, short-term operational plans, and identifying strategic priorities.
  • Manage and coach the graduate programs team to meet enrollment goals, increase applications, provide strong customer service, and screen candidates for all programs.
  • Set performance expectations with team members, coaching them to attain those expectations, and providing feedback throughout the year on their success towards those expectations.
  • Build strong team culture, positive communication, and a healthy work environment through positive leadership.
  • Cultivate and manage a broad spectrum of internal and external working relationships.
  • Manage the daily operations of the ACBE graduate programs office.
  • Develop a culture of continuous improvement.
